Refresh Your CV and Social Profiles

If you’re planning a career move in 2024, reviewing and updating your CV and social media profiles is a sensible first step. Thanks to the abundance of generative AI tools available, you can leverage AI to refine the content of your CV, social profiles and cover letters. When using these tools, watch out things like American spelling, and ensure the text is factually correct. Employers and tech recruitment agencies understand people will lean on AI for job applications, but it pays to use it sparingly, as much of its output has an obvious ‘written by AI’ tone.


When refreshing your CV, remember to hone in on your achievements in each role, instead of simply listing your job responsibilities.


CV examples: 


  • Someone working in cloud and DevOps discussing their achievements in scalable infrastructure architecture: Designed and implemented a cloud infrastructure that seamlessly scaled to accommodate a 50% increase in user traffic during a product launch.
  • A data and analytics professional describing an achievement in advanced data visualisation: Designed interactive dashboards that provided actionable insights, enabling stakeholders to make informed decisions and contributing to a 15% increase in operational efficiency.


Prioritise Continuous Skill Enhancement

Skills stagnation is the enemy to career growth. And in 2024, employers will be seeking candidates who can demonstrate they’re proactive in gaining new skills. Upskilling ensures your CV is up to date and aligns with evolving tech jobs and broader market forces.


Here’s a few examples of how to demonstrate new skills you’re acquired on your CV:


  • A cybersecurity professional listing advanced certification achievements: Pursued and completed Offensive Security Certified Professional (OSCP) training, showcasing dedication to hands-on penetration testing skills.
  • A project services professional outlining the advanced project management certifications they’ve acquired: Achieved Project Management Professional (PMP) certification, showcasing expertise in project management methodologies.


Become a Trend Spotter and Interpreter

Employers value candidates who stay on top of industry trends and are curious about the future potential of their industry and it’s not uncommon for hiring managers to ask your thoughts about specific trends or predictions about your discipline.


If trend spotting isn’t a particular strength, why not consider some of the avenues listed below to elevate your game?


Examples include:


  • Subscribing to news and social feeds about your industry
  • Following online discussions
  • Engaging with industry reports
  • Attending conferences or participating in forums or webinars
  • Monitoring evolving methodologies that relate to your profession


Stand Out Online

Your online presence is often the first touchpoint for recruiters and hiring managers, and always has the potential to land you a job opportunity.


Addressing your LinkedIn profile specifically, here’s how to ensure your page is discoverable and optimised for a tap on the shoulder from a recruiter or hiring manager:


LinkedIn headline and summary:


  • A well-crafted headline and summary providing a quick snapshot of your skills and expertise.
  • Include relevant keywords (e.g., Cloud Solutions Architect, AWS, DevOps) improves search visibility for recruiters and employers.
  • Highlight your passions and accomplishments to create a compelling narrative and encourages profile visitors to learn more about you.


Showcase technical skills and certifications:


  • A well-defined skills section to help employers quickly identify your technical strengths.
  • Include relevant certifications to add credibility and demonstrates your commitment to continuous learning.
  • Regularly update your skills and certifications to ensure your profile accurately reflects your current expertise.


Highlight achievements with impactful experience descriptions:


  • Use specific, quantifiable achievements to showcase your impact in previous roles.
  • Highlight technologies and methodologies you’ve worked to give employers insights into your hands-on experience.
  • Tailor experience descriptions to align with the tech roles you’re targeting, emphasising relevant accomplishments.
